Thanks, I'l try this On Monday, January 22, 2018 at 12:31:12 PM UTC-5, Matt Martz wrote: > > Probably something like: > > - name: Ensure M_upgrade - M_installed = 1 > assert: > that: > - M_upgrade|int - M_installed|int == 1 > > On Mon, Jan 22, 2018 at 11:18 AM, ZillaYT <[email protected] <javascript:>> > wrote: > >> I have an Ansible task that aims to upgrade our Gitlab application. I >> want the user to ONLY be able to upgrade 1 major release. For example, I >> want to enable a 8.x to 9.x upgrade, but not an 8.x to 10.x upgrade. I'm >> aware of the version_compare module, which I use, but need more than what >> it does. >> >> I did write a filter that extracts the major, minor, patch versions of a >> Semver-format version so I can get the major part.
